The ketogenic diet commonly referred to as “keto,” is a low-carb, high-fat diet that has been shown to aid in weight loss and improve overall health markers.

For those who follow a vegetarian lifestyle, it can be a bit more difficult to adhere to a keto diet, as many traditional keto staples such as meat and eggs are off-limits.

However, with a bit of creativity and meal planning, it is certainly possible to follow a vegetarian keto diet. In this blog post, we will provide a 7-day vegetarian keto meal plan that is completely egg-free.
